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
446 19 3838672946 1113165243
3949002151 03999384538 8751474
3949002151 03999384538 8751474
92056768 985801 643536
All about undefined
Interested in learning more?
3949002151 03999384538 8751474
92056768 985801 643536
See more
39 284069077 53001
06 379840909 781654
See more
278 93256 9583866999
0742560 245 29 037
See more